I can see why - they look great and they're easy to do! I made my first spinners in '08 by zip-tying C6 LED's onto round green garden stakes. They looked excellent, but they were pretty labor-intensive having to zip-tie each light. At the end of the season I bought a bunch of lighted candy canes and before I even put things away I made my first pinwheel spinner using them. I immediately wished I had bought more. What a difference in build time - using the candy canes reduced it from 3+ hours per spinner down to 30 minutes.

Update on the Target purple candy canes - they suck. With clear lights in them when you plug them in they actually look like a putrid faded pink. I'm going to strip out the clear incans and replace them with purple C6 LED's tomorrow and will report back.
